Gateron Magnetic Jade vs SteelSeries OmniPoint 2.0

The Gateron Magnetic Jade and the SteelSeries OmniPoint 2.0 are often cross-shopped. The main differences: do not assume you can swap one for the other: Hall-effect compatibility is board-specific, so check your keyboard's supported-switch list before buying either; travel is 3.5 mm on the Gateron Magnetic Jade and 3.8 mm on the SteelSeries OmniPoint 2.0; stock they sound different: clacky, poppy versus magnetic gaming linear.
